Description

Beef Tallow is a rendered form of beef fat, a natural and versatile lipid material with the CAS registry number 61789-97-7. It serves as a crucial raw material and functional ingredient across numerous industries due to its unique fatty acid profile and physical properties. Key industrial users include manufacturers in the food, personal care, chemical synthesis, and oleochemical sectors.

Application

  • Food Industry: Used as a cooking fat, shortening agent, and flavor carrier in baked goods, confectionery, and traditional food preparations.
  • Personal Care & Cosmetics: Acts as an emollient and thickening agent in the formulation of soaps, creams, lotions, and lip balms.
  • Oleochemical Feedstock: A primary raw material for the production of fatty acids, fatty alcohols, glycerin, and biodiesel through processes like hydrolysis and transesterification.
  • Animal Feed: Incorporated as a high-energy fat supplement in livestock and poultry feed formulations.
  • Lubricants & Greases: Serves as a base or additive in the manufacture of biodegradable lubricants, metalworking fluids, and specialty greases.
  • Leather Processing: Used in fatliquoring to soften and waterproof leather.
  • Candle Making: A traditional and renewable base material for producing tallow candles.
  • Technical Applications: Employed as a mold release agent, a component in rust preventatives, and in other industrial formulations.

Basic Information

Product Name Beef Tallow
CAS No. 61789-97-7
Molecular Formula Complex mixture of triglycerides
Molecular Weight N/A (Variable mixture)
Synonyms Tallow; Edible Tallow; Beef Fat; Rendered Beef Fat; Oleum Bovis; Adeps Bovis; Tallow Oil; Tallow Flakes; Prime Tallow; Fats and Glyceridic oils, beef
EINECS 263-099-1

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area. Due to its nature as an easily oxidized (store under inert atmosphere) material, prolonged exposure to air and high temperatures should be avoided to maintain quality and shelf life. For long-term storage, a temperature below 25°C (77°F) is recommended.

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ance Off-white to pale yellow solid/fat
Odor Characteristic, mild
Acid Value (mg KOH/g) ≤ 2.0
Peroxide Value (meq/kg) ≤ 5.0
Iodine Value (Wijs) 35 - 48
Saponification Value (mg KOH/g) 190 - 200
Moisture (%) ≤ 0.5
Unsaponifiable Matter (%) ≤ 1.0
FFA (as Oleic Acid, %) ≤ 1.0
